
### Struggling with Outlook Login
Every attempt to log into Outlook triggers the same frustrating message:
> "You've tried to sign in too many times."
The problem repeats no matter how long the user waits before the next attempt. Resetting the password, clearing cookies, or switching browsers brings no improvement. Outlook continues to block access, leaving the sign-in screen stuck in an endless loop of failed authentication.

### Attempts to Fix
Common troubleshooting steps include:
- Clearing cookies and browser cache.
- Trying incognito mode or another browser.
- Resetting the Microsoft account password.
- Turning off two-step verification temporarily.
Despite these efforts, many find no success until Microsoft’s servers reset automatic lockout limits.
